Contracts across the network blew up by $124 million in the last 24 hours
According to Coinglass, the cryptocurrency market has seen $124 million in contract outages across the web in the last 24 hours, including $41,248,500 in long positions and $82,420,000 in short positions, $23.3 million in ETH outages and $42.8 million in BTC outages. In the last 24 hours, a total of 41,787 people had their positions blown out, with the largest single blown out order occurring on Bybit - BTCUSD valued at $88.093 million.
